About Peter Kearney

Peter Kearney is a scholar working on Surgery,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 41 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Coronary Interventions and Diagnostics (21 papers),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(17 papers), Acute Myocardial Infarction Research (10 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(5 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(5 papers), Ultrasound Imaging and Elastography (3 papers), Cardiovascular Disease and Adiposity (3 papers) and Kawasaki Disease and Coronary Complications (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(779 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(492 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(667 citations), Surgery (861 citations) and Internal Medicine (16 citations). Peter Kearney has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United Kingdom and Ireland. Frequent co-authors include Susanne Mohr-Kahaly, Junbo Ge, Jürgen Meyer, Raimund Erbel, Michael Haude, J. Meyer, Günter Görge, H. J. Rupprecht, George R. Sutherland and Ian R. Starkey. Their work appears in journals such as European Heart Journal, International journal of cardiac imaging, Ultrasound in Medicine & Biology, Heart and Coronary Artery Disease.
